Miady 2-Pack 5000mAh Mini Portable Charger — a dual-unit bundle offering two compact power banks, each with 5000mAh capacity and built-in USB-C connectors. Designed for phone top-ups and light travel. Each unit provides a single USB-C output (no separate input port visible; charging likely via the connector itself). The six-color bundle (Black, White, Lake Green, Clove Purple, Cream Blue, Champagne Pink) appeals to those wanting variety or sharing.

Key Trade-offs: At ~$48 per bank (based on lowest listed price), the 5000mAh capacity is on the smaller end of the portable power bank spectrum—suitable only for one partial phone charge. No wattage or fast-charge standard (USB-C PD) specs disclosed; output likely ~5W (standard for this class). The ultra-compact size is a genuine pro, but real-world efficiency and charge speed remain unconfirmed. Miady is a lesser-known brand with minimal professional review coverage or community endorsement in r/PowerBank or r/UsbCHardware. Return rate and defect reports are sparse, reflecting low volume rather than proven reliability. Best suited for minimalist phone-only travelers or as a novelty multi-pack gift.
